First day of early voting sets record
Haywood County voters set a new record Thursday when the polls opened for one-stop absentee voting.At the two early voting sites, the Haywood County Senior Resources Center and the Canton branch of the Haywood County Public library, more than 1,300 votes were cast on the first day the polls opened.Robert Inman, Haywood County Board of Elections director, said there were 1,346 votes cast.
In the 2010 election, only 492 voters showed up the first day, while 1,132 voters weighed in on the first day of early voting in the 2008 election.
"Please ask your readers to thank and appreciate their poll workers," Inman said. "Without their selfless dedication, elections in this county could not be possible. They work long hours for very little, so a simple thank you is the least any of us can do."
